Letter of good standing

A letter of good standing confirms the student is a registered student with the Institute of Chartered Accountants of Ontario.   This letter can be used when proof of student status is required, such as loan applications and the IQEX exams.

A written request should be sent to customer service at custserv@icao.on.ca  including the name of the Chartered Accountant and the current address.   There is no charge for this letter and the request will be responded to within 1 week.

Transcript

A transcript is an official record of education and experience history with the Institute of Chartered Accountants of Ontario. It summarizes the educational professional program components, the prescribed practical experience completed and, if applicable provides the date of admission to membership.  

You may request to have a transcript sent directly to a third party. Or, you may request a personal copy of your transcript that will be stamped “Issued to Student” and placed in a sealed envelope.   To order a transcript, complete the Transcript Request Form.   Transcripts with member join dates post 1996 typically take five to ten business days.   All other transcripts can take ten to fifteen business days to process.

The cost for an active CA student or CA member transcript is $15.75 ($15.00 + $0.75 GST).  The cost for a non-active CA student or CA member transcript is $105.00 ($100.00 + $5.00 GST).  Four copies of the transcript will be provided.  

Access to records

Students may login to the website to review and update their profile at any time.  The detailed demographic information displayed during the annual student fees renewal process and during examination registrations reflects the student’s particulars in the Institute records as at the date indicated with each application.   The record should be reviewed carefully to ensure accuracy.   Upon written request, hard copy of the student’s file will be provided for no cost.  Ten to fifteen business days are required.

Tax Receipts

Official receipts for income tax purposes covering tuition fees paid for qualifying courses, annual fees and exams taken during the preceding calendar year are available online in late February. In accordance with section 118.5 of the Income Tax Act, T2202A receipts are issued to students attending the full school of accountancy. Materials and administrative fees are not eligible for tax deduction.
